Although the overall entry numbers were disappointing we had a very enjoyable meeting at Dale, the circuit is well worth the effort to get there and Mark & Andy put a lot of effort into preparing the track and getting feedback from all the riders on ways to improve it for the future. Most riders were a little cautious at first but by the end of the second day everyone seemed to have really got to grips with the track. Ady Smith said it was physically the most demanding circuit he had ever ridden and was a very enjoyable meeting. Christian Iddon was impressed enough to offer his services to help Mark & Andy work on improvements for the future.

A full race report will be emailed out separately but as four of our five solo championships were settled at Dale we would like to congratulate the winners. A full point’s breakdown is pasted below and we will need to wait until our final round in Northern Ireland on 21st November to see who triumphs in the SM Lites between Oliver Harrison & Lee Rudd. There are still 60 points to go for and a quite a few of the place positions are up for grabs.
I’m sure you will all join us in congratulating the following riders on their fantastic achievements;
PROPPA.COM! 2009 ELITE BRITISH SUPERMOTO CHAMPION – #21 CHRISTIAN IDDON (KTM UK KTM) 620 points
NAMEPLATE SERVICES 2009 JUNIOR BRITISH SUPERMOTO CHAMPION – #111 JOE COLLIER (MC MOTORS HONDA) 690 points
HEAVY DUTY FORKLIFTS 2009 SM CUP BRITISH SUPERMOTO CHAMPION – #37 BRUCE DINGLE (APRILIA VDB) 626 points
DRAYTON CROFT M/C’s/ALICE RACING SXV CHALLENGE 2009 CHAMPION – #37 BRUCE DINGLE (APRILIA VDB) 718 points
